Looking for a new way to prepare your garden's zucchini harvest? Make low-carb zucchini noodles, aka zoodles, with a spiralizer! You can make this dish in 25 minutes, with no waiting for the water to boil. The uncooked zucchini is tossed with hot olive oil and a blend of parsley, ground walnuts, and Parmesan cheese, and then topped with fresh tomatoes and olives. The hot olive oil makes it warm, but this is not a hot dish.

Steps:
- Place Parmesan cheese in the bowl of a food processor; process into small crumbs. Add walnuts and process into small crumbs.
-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at until hot. Stir in parsley and garlic and remove from heat. Toss zucchini noodles with the hot oil mixture and Parmesan-walnut mixture. Top with cherry tomatoes and olives to serve.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 1127.7 calories, Carbohydrate 38.1 g, Cholesterol 43.7 mg, Fat 98.9 g, Fiber 10.6 g, Protein 33.8 g, SaturatedFat 18.7 g, Sodium 1929.9 mg, Sugar 7.5 g
